About this ebook

In this companion to acclaimed Mary and the Mouse, the Mouse and Mary, Maria (Mary's daughter) and Mouse Mouse (Mouse's daughter) are looking for their mothers. They're not in their bedrooms, their car and cart are still in the driveway, and they are not in the gazebo or under the mushroom! Where could they be? Well, turns out Mary and the Mouse are great friends—just like Maria and Mouse Mouse—and soon the new generation is in on the old generation's secret, and vice versa. Sparingly told and beautifully illustrated, this book is every bit as charming as its predecessor. Kids will pore over the minute details of a mouse's parallel world.

About the author

BEVERLY DONOFRIO is the author of the adult titles Riding in Cars with Boys andLooking for Mary, as well as the coauthor of Mafia Marriage. The picture book Mary and the Mouse received two starred reviews. Ms. Donofrio is also the author of a middle-grade novel, Thank You, Lucky Stars.

BARBARA McCLINTOCK is the author and illustrator of many highly acclaimed books for children, including Cinderella, a Golden Kite Honor Book; Dahlia, a Boston Globe-Horn Book Honor Book and a Child Magazine Best Kids' Book of the Year; and Adele & Simon, which received two starred reviews and was named an ALA Notable Book. She is also the illustrator of The Gingerbread Man by Jim Ayelsworth, among others.
